1. A method of producing without subsequent mechanical treatment a composite sintered body having different cross-sectional configurations and different dimensions at different locations along a main axis and good dimensional accuracy by compression molding a sintering powder in the direction of the main axis and subsequently sintering, comprising the steps of:

  • (a) compression molding from a sintering powder at least two partial bodies, each one of the partial bodies having a simpler geometric shape than the composite sintered body and improved uniform density distribution and forming a different axial portion of the sintered body, the partial bodies being shaped so that they may be form-fitted into each other in the direction of the main axis,(b) form-fitting the separately compression molded partial bodies into each other in the direction of the main axis to join them, and(c) jointly sintering the joined partial bodies to produce the composite sintered body.
